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 2 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 16 ounces (454 grams) cream cheese
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 3 large eggs
Binding and Flavoring Ingredients:
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up corn syrup
Topping Ingredient:
- 1 cup pecans
Instructions
- Prepare a 9×13-inch baking pan by lining with parchment paper, creating overhanging edges for easy removal.
- Crush graham crackers and combine with melted butter, pressing firmly into the pan’s bottom to create an even, compact base layer.
- Bake the crust at 350°F for 10 minutes until lightly golden, then remove and let cool completely.
- In a large mixing bowl, whip cream cheese until smooth and creamy, gradually incorporating s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ract until fully blended.
- Gently pour the cream cheese mixture over the cooled graham cracker crust, spreading evenly with a spatula.
- Create the pecan topping by whisking together brown sugar, corn syrup, and eggs until thoroughly combined.
- Fold chopped pecans into the syrup mixture, ensuring they are evenly distributed.
- Carefully pour the pecan topping over the cheesecake layer, covering the surface completely.
- Bake at 350°F for 35-40 minutes, or until the center is set and the edges are slightly puffed.
- Remove from oven and let cool at room temperature for 1 hour,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ours before cutting into bars.
- Use the parchment paper edges to lift the dessert from the pan, slice into squares, and serve chilled.
Notes
- Elevate the crust’s texture by toasting graham cracker crumbs in the oven for a few minutes before mixing with butter, enhancing its nutty flavor and crispness.
- Create a gluten-free version by substituting graham crackers with almond flour or gluten-free cookie crumbs, ensuring everyone can enjoy this decadent dessert.
- Prevent cracks in the cheesecake layer by beating ingredients at room temperature and avoiding overmixing, which can incorporate too much air and cause splitting.
- Achieve a glossy, professional-looking pecan topping by gently warming the brown sugar and corn syrup mixture before pouring over the cheesecake, ensuring smooth and even coverage.
